New Talent Bonsai Competition

The Joshua Roth New Talent Bonsai Competition Supported by ABS

The Joshua Roth New Talent Bonsai Competition is an annual competition to recognize and promote new bonsai talent in North America. First prize is an exclusive course of instruction with an approved bonsai teacher. The first stage of the competition is a judging of photographs of previously designed trees by the entrant. The second stage will be the actual production of a bonsai during the "”Bonsai in the Bluegrass” Bonsai Convention and Learning Seminar in Louisville, Kentucky, Louisville, KY at the Fern Valley Hotel and Convention Center, June 16-19, 2011.  The American Bonsai Society, Bonsai Clubs International and the Greater Louisville Bonsai Society are sponsoring the event.

Eligibility requirements

Any person who lives in North America, including Puerto Rico, is eligible.  He or she must have been involved with the art of bonsai for less than ten (10) years.  Any past winner or runner-up is ineligible to enter.  Participation in the second stage is limited to two (2) competitions.

First stage submissions

Each contestant shall submit photographs of at least three bonsai that he or she has personally styled. More than one picture of each bonsai is preferred. The photographs do not have to be of publication quality; however, they should show the talent of the artist to the best advantage.
All of the photographs submitted shall be enclosed in a single presentation folder with the photos enclosed in clear plastic sleeves. A brief description and history of each bonsai shall also be enclosed. Taped to the back inside cover of the folder shall be an envelope with the completed application form. There should be no identification on the photos or on the outside of the enclosed envelope. Mail all entries to:

First Stage Submissions must be received before Saturday April 16, 2011. Entries from artists whose photographs indicate the most promise will be selected to participate in the second stage of the competition. Contestants selected for Stage Two will be notified by Friday April 29, 2011.

Stage Two

Each contestant selected for the second stage of the competition must come to the "Bonsai in the Bluegrass" Bonsai convention and Learning Seminar.  Each contestant must pay his or her own expenses to the Bonsai Convention and Learning Seminar.

Each contestant shall:

1) Be provided with pre-bonsai material and wire by the Competition.
2) Furnish his or her personal tools and turntable. Power tools are acceptable.
3) Be given an eight (8) hour time period in which to style the material into a finished bonsai. The competition will begin at 8 AM and will close at 5 PM, on Thursday June 16, 2011. There will be an optional one-hour lunch break.

Repotting of the finished bonsai will not be done during the competition.

Judging

Four of the major presenters at the Convention and Learning Seminar will judge the completed bonsai. In addition, all registrants at the "Bonsai in the Bluegrass" will be able to vote for their personal choice. The "popular vote" is worth one vote. The artist whose bonsai receives the majority of the five votes will be awarded the title of "Best New Bonsai Talent of 2011" at the Saturday evening Banquet.
